Jezersko–Solčava Sheep

The Jezersko–Solčava sheep is a rare breed from Slovenia raised for wool. This mountain sheep has medium wool and a docile temperament. Ewes average 121 lbs, while rams reach around 176 lbs. Jezersko–Solčava Sheep Facts Quick List

  • Type: Mountain
  • Primary Use: Wool
  • Rarity: Rare
  • Country of Origin: Slovenia
  • Wool Type: Medium
  • Horn Status: Polled
  • Average Ewe Weight: 55 kg / 121 lbs
  • Average Ram Weight: 80 kg / 176 lbs
  • Temperament: Docile
  • Breed Status: Extant
  • Special Traits or Notes: Popular Slovenian breed used in both meat and wool production; adapted to alpine zones.
